Another livewire Jumbo MG from the fine folks at McPherson. This 2010 4.0XPH is decked out with top shelf figured Brazilian Rosewood and gorgeous Curly Black Redwood on top—something of the most eye catching tonewoods we’ve seen in a long while. The McPherson team obviously knows tonewood. The deep figure of the top comes alive under light, with large central curl tastefully transitioning into wide flame along the periphery. And that’s just the visual aspect: tonally, the Redwood and BRW work together for a powerful bass register that pairs nicely with a sweet, present midrange, and smooth trebles. Notes have great blossom and bloom when played with fingers, growing stronger and fuller as they ring out. Whether you play fingerstyle or with a pick, you'll appreciate the venetian cutaway and L.R. Baggs pickup system for both recording and live performances.
